UPI Goes Live in Cambodia: A Game Changer for Indian Travelers

In a significant move for cross-border tourism, India and Cambodia have officially launched UPI-based digital payment connectivity today . The National Payments Corporation of India (NPCI) partnered with ACLEDA Bank to allow Indian tourists to pay seamlessly at merchant locations across Cambodia using Indian UPI apps.

Why it matters for B2B

This reduces friction for the large volume of Indian tourists visiting Cambodia, making destinations like Siem Reap and Phnom Penh more accessible. For Southeast Asian businesses, it integrates Indian travelers into the local digital payment ecosystem .

As of June 2026, UPI is accepted for merchant payments in 11 countries. The most recent addition is Cambodia, which went live on June 2, 2026 .

Here is the complete list:

Country Key Notes
🇦🇪 UAE Widely available at shopping malls, restaurants, and major tourist destinations .
🇸🇬 Singapore Accepted at marketplaces, restaurants, and various merchant locations; established via the UPI-PayNow linkage .
🇧🇹 Bhutan One of the earliest adopters of UPI for cross-border payments .
🇳🇵 Nepal Enables hassle-free QR code payments at local venues and restaurants .
🇱🇰 Sri Lanka Accepted at local shopping venues and merchant establishments .
🇫🇷 France Available at select merchant outlets and tourist-heavy locations (like Paris and Nice) .
🇲🇺 Mauritius Accepted at beach markets, local shops, and tourist venues .
🇶🇦 Qatar Facilitates payments at select merchant outlets .
🇰🇭 Cambodia Latest addition (June 2026). Live at over 4.5 million KHQR-enabled merchant outlets .
🇲🇾 Malaysia Available via partnerships for QR payments .
🇨🇾 Cyprus Enabled for QR payments .
🇴🇲 Oman Accessible for QR code-based transactions .
